Ethereum: Will a Schnorr soft-fork introduce a new address format (i.e. not bech32)

Will a schnorr soft-fork introduction a new address format?

The Ethereum Blockchain is Undergoing Significant Changes with Each New Hard Fork, One of which has sparked intense Debate Among Developers and Users. The upcoming schnorr soft-fork aims to introduction a new address format, but the question remains: will it bring about a fundamental change in how we think about ethereum addresses?

What is Schnorr Signatures?

Ethereum: Will a Schnorr soft-fork introduce a new address format (i.e. not bech32)

Schnorr signatures are an alternative way of representation digital identities on the blockchain. Unlike Traditional Public-Key Cryptography (PK) Schemes That use private keys to encrypt data, Schnorr signatures use a “public key” as a single input to compute the decryption key. This approach Enables faster and more secure transactions without compromising the user’s privacy.

Bech32 Addresses: The Current Standard

Traditional Ethereum Addresses Are Stored In A Format Similar to Bitcoin’s, With the First 64 Characters (E.G., 0X ... `) Representation the hash of the public key and the remoining part being a hexadecimal checksum. This Structure is called Bech32. While it has its advantages, such as high scalability, bech32 Addresses can lead to confusion for users who are battery to traditional addresses.

The Schnorr Soft-Fork: A New Address Format?

In May 2021, Ethereum Developers Announced Plans to Introduction A New Address Format Based on the Schnorr Signature Scheme. The goal was to create an indistinguishable Address from Those Currently Using Bech32. This change will enable faster transaction processing without the need for additional gas.

Will the new addresses be indistinguishable from bech32?

In Theory, The New Schnorr Addresses Should Not Be Easily Distinguishable from Traditional Bech32 Addresses. The Difference Lies in the Format and Structure of the Addresses Themselves:

  • Traditional Ethereum Addresses Are 44 Hexadecimal Characters Long.

  • Bech32 Addresses, As Mentioned Earlier, Have A Fixed First 64 Characters (hash) Followed by A Checksum.

Potential issues

While the New Schnorr Addresses May Not Be Distinguishable From Traditional Bech32, There Are Some Potential Issues to Consider:

  • Confusion Among Users : Some Users Might Still Prefer to use traditional Bech32 Addresses for Security Reasons or Familiarity.

  • Compatibility with Legacy Software and Applications : IR Older Systems or Apps Rely Havily on Bech32 Addresses, They May Not Support the New Schnorr Format Seamlesly.

Conclusion

The upcoming schnorr soft-fork aims to revolutionize ethereum’s address system by introducing a new format that is indistinguishable from traditional bech32. While there are potential Issues to Consider, Such as user confusion and compatibility groups, It’s Likely that the New Addresses Will Become the Standard for Ethereum. As developers continuous to experiment with this change, we can expect the ethereum community to adapt and find ways to make the transition as smooth as possible.

Stay Tuned : The Schnorr Soft-Fork is expected to be implemented in the Coming Months, with Various Testing Phases Already Underway. Stay informed through reputable sources, such as ethereum.org, to stay up-to-date on the latest development and any potential changes that may affect your daily life on the blockchain.

Leave a Comment